Level 4 lockdown, challenges facing businesses opening
As South Africa grappled with the partial lifting of restrictions under Level 4, franchise members have been contacting the association with many questions that have come out as a result of the regulations with many things up in the air in terms of the exact requirements needed to open. Franchisors are busy strategizing whether it will pay them to open and balance the potential income to the costs of operating.
